ANT+ Sensors
gSC 10
Cadence data from the GSC 10 is 
always recorded. If there is no GSC 10 
paired, GPS data is used to calculate 
the speed and distance. Cadence is 
your rate of pedaling or “spinning” 
measured by the number of revolutions 
of the crank arm per minute (rpm). 
There are two sensors on the GSC 10: 
one for cadence and one for speed.
Calibrating Your Bike Sensor
Before you customize the bike sensor 
options, you must change your sport to 
Before you can calibrate your bike 
sensor, it must be properly installed 
and actively recording data. 
Calibrating your bike sensor is 
optional and can improve accuracy. 
For calibration instructions specific 
to your power meter, refer to the 
manufacturer’s instructions.
1.  Select   > Setup > Bike Sensor 
Calibration.
2.  Select an option:
•  To use GPS to determine your 
wheel size, select Auto.
•  To enter your wheel size, select 
Manual.
